Is Private Selection™ Triple Layer Carrot Cake Vegetarian?


Ingredients
Cake: Sugar, Enriched Bleached Flour (Wheat Flour, Malted Barley Flour, Niacin, Reduced Iron, Thiamine Mononitrate, Riboflavin, Folic Acid), Carrots, Eggs, Water, Pecans, Pineapple, Raisins, Soybean Oil, Coconut, Corn Syrup Solids, Modified Corn Starch, Nonfat Milk, Leavening (Sodium Bicarbonate, Sodium Aluminum Phosphate), Emulsifiers (Propylene Glycol Monoester, Mono and Diglycerides, Soy Lecithin), Soy Flour, Salt, Spices, Xanthan Gum. Icing: Cream Cheese (Pasteurized Cultured Milk and Cream, Cheese Cultures, Salt, Carob Bean Gum, Guar Gum), Xanthan Gum, Sugar, Corn Starch, Vanilla Extract, Vanilla Flavor (Water, Caramel Color, Artificial Flavors, Potassium Sorbate [Preservative]), Ethyl Vanillin. Toppings: Walnuts, Sugar, Vegetable Oil (Palm Kernel Oil, Hydrogenated Palm Kernel Oil), Cocoa Butter, Whole Milk Powder, Skim Milk Powder, Whole Milk Solids, Nonfat Dry Milk Solids, Lactose, Whey, Soy Lecithin, Salt, Vanilla, Paprika Extract, Spinach Extract (Color), Artificial Flavor, Artificial Color, Yellow 6 Lake, Yellow 5 Lake, Blue 1 Lake, Salt
What is a Vegetarian diet?
A vegetarian diet eliminates meat, poultry, and fish but typically includes dairy, eggs, and plant-based foods. People adopt it for ethical, environmental, or health reasons. This diet emphasizes fruits, vegetables, legumes, grains, nuts, and seeds as key nutrient sources. Vegetarians often get protein from eggs, tofu, beans, and lentils. It can offer health benefits such as reduced risk of heart disease and improved weight management, though attention should be given to nutrients like iron, zinc, and vitamin B12. With proper planning, a vegetarian diet can be both nutritionally complete and sustainable.
